Powerday Extend Their Support For An Eleventh Season

London Irish is delighted to announce that Powerday will continue as the Principal Partner for the 2021/22 season.

As the main sponsor and key investor of the Club, Powerday – the largest family-owned recycling and waste management company in the South East of England – will support London Irish as the Club’s main sponsor for the ninth successive season.

To recognise this essential investment and support, Powerday branding will feature prominently on London Irish’s home and away kit, along with all training apparel and branding opportunities at the Hazelwood training complex and also the magnificent Brentford Community Stadium throughout the 2021/22 rugby season.

Off the pitch, London Irish and Powerday will continue to mutually collaborate on a wide range of bespoke events and unique initiatives, whilst ensuring their joint impact delivers exceptional positive outcomes for individuals and communities across London in some of the most hard to reach areas and estates.
